A Postgraduate Certificate in Protein Structure Prediction Modernization provides specialized training in cutting-edge computational biology techniques. Students will gain proficiency in analyzing complex biological data and employing advanced algorithms for accurate protein structure prediction.
Learning outcomes include mastering protein modeling software, understanding various prediction methodologies (like AlphaFold and Rosetta), and developing skills in data visualization and interpretation. The program emphasizes practical application, equipping graduates with the ability to contribute significantly to research and development.
The duration of this certificate program typically ranges from six to twelve months, depending on the institution and the student's study load. The curriculum is designed for flexibility, accommodating professionals seeking upskilling or career advancement in the field of bioinformatics.
